Blotter for April 9, 2013

By Staff Report | Police Blotter

Carrie T. Emigh, 35, of Webster St. in Saratoga Springs was arrested April 3 for disorderly conduct, a violation charge. Officers responded to the Bullpen Bar on Caroline Street for an unwanted guest. Upon officers arrival they were informed that a female (Emigh) had been asked to leave the bar and refused to do so. Emigh was advised by officers she needed to leave the bar. When she refused to do so, she was placed under arrest. Emigh was transported to the police department, processed and released on an appearance ticket.

Joshua E. Chambers, 37, of Prospect St. in Greenwich was charged with refusing a pre-screen test, a violation, and being ability impaired by drugs, a Class A misdemeanor on April 3. Chambers vehicle was stopped on South Broadway. Chambers appeared to be under the influence of possibly narcotics and refused a screening test when asked by officers. Chambers was placed under arrest and charged with DWI Drugs. Chambers was transported to the police department where he was processed and celled pending a City Court arraignment.

William W. Tobin, 54, of West Harrison St., Saratoga Springs was arrested April 3 and charged with four counts of criminal sale of a controlled substance and eight counts of criminal possession of a controlled substance. Tobin turned himself in to members of the Saratoga Springs Police Department Narcotics Unit after a six month search. Tobin was the focus of a narcotics investigation for the sales of cocaine. He was indicted in the fall of 2012 and fled the area. Tobin voluntarily surrendered without incident, was processed and remanded to Saratoga County Jail in lieu of $50,000 cash or $100,000 bond.
